Relating to or derived from fat; of or pertaining to adipose tissue or fatty substances.
From Latin adipem (fat) plus -ic (adjective suffix). Adipic acid is a compound derived from fats used in making nylon.
Adipic acid, used to manufacture nylon and polyester, comes from petroleum or can be made from glucose—so your clothes might literally be made from processed sugar!
